Output 7a0253fcb574cf101699377fad87da3f3523ac527f16b4d4861f713b13d647e7:509

value
53869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ab99c52c7378ae1a78d3ddaedd726d3ca70215b9 OP_EQUAL
address
MPYVzNgauX6KX2eN7EpdcVYiUqGtnt6EyY
transaction
7a0253fcb574cf101699377fad87da3f3523ac527f16b4d4861f713b13d647e7
spent
true